§ 42-4-104 — Powers and duties of department of health; state Medicaid agent appointed by governor

Wyoming·Title 42 Welfare·Ch. 4 MEDICAL ASSISTANCE AND SERVICES·Art. 1 IN GENERAL
(a)The department of health shall:
(i)Administer this chapter;
(ii)Develop a state plan for medical assistance and services provided to qualified recipients under this chapter and otherwise providing for the effective administration of this chapter;
(iii)Maintain records on the administration of this chapter, report to the federal government as required by federal law and regulation and within limitations imposed under W.S. 42-4-112, may provide for the availability of information on the administration of this chapter to interested persons;
(iv)Adopt, amend and rescind rules and regulations on the administration of this chapter following notice and public hearing in accordance with the Wyoming Administrative Procedure Act.
